What is a from home Quantum Fiber job?

A From Home Quantum Fiber job typically refers to remote positions offered by Quantum Fiber, an internet service provider that specializes in high-speed fiber-optic internet. These roles may include customer service, technical support, or sales positions that can be performed from the comfort of your home. Employees use company-provided technology to assist customers, resolve issues, or process orders. Working from home allows for flexibility while still supporting Quantum Fiber’s mission to deliver reliable internet services. Applicants usually need a quiet workspace and a reliable internet connection to be eligible.

What are common challenges faced by remote customer service representatives working for Quantum Fiber from home?

Remote customer service representatives at Quantum Fiber may encounter challenges such as managing complex technical inquiries without in-person team support and maintaining high productivity in a home environment. Balancing multiple communication channels, such as phone, chat, and email, while adhering to strict performance metrics can also be demanding. However, the company typically provides training, virtual team meetings, and resources to help representatives stay connected and supported. Establishing a dedicated workspace and a consistent routine can help overcome these challenges and ensure a successful work-from-home experience.

The Role

This entry-level role involves installing, repairing, and testing internet and broadband services for homes and small businesses. Responsibilities include communicating clearly with customers, assessing and explaining installation or repair processes, enabling networks on approved modems/routers, connecting cables, attaching hardware, and troubleshooting fiber drops. No experience is required, but willingness to work outdoors and some customer service or related experience are preferred.

 Work Location:  4755 1st Ave S, Seattle WA

The Main Responsibilities

  • Perform all in-home installation and service work for consumer and small business customers, including ONT, SmartNID, gateways, extenders, Ethernet, copper, and fiber inside wiring.
  • Interact with customers professionally and courteously (on‑site and by phone); explain features, usage, applications, and equipment capabilities.
  • Evaluate customer needs and appropriately identify and communicate additional/alternative service opportunities.
  • Conduct Line Station Transfer (LST) tasks such as F2 port changes and splitter port modifications.
  • Install, repair, reconnect, rearrange and hang aerial drops as needed for service delivery and service repair.
  • Place, flag, and bury or dig in buried drops for permanent installations.
  • Place, flag, and bury or dig in temporary buried drops.
  • Repair buried drops by placing new drops or repairing existing ones.
  • Isolate fiber troubles using tools such as OTDR, Opti-meter, or fault finder.
  • Install mechanical connectors using the appropriate installation kit and connectors.
  • Perform fiber fusion splicing, whether existing or new.
  • Place and repair aerial fiber enclosures as part of the service process.
  • Place and repair buried fiber enclosures as needed.
  • Replace connectorized terminals to install, maintain or restore service.
  • Attach or re-attach cables to poles safely and securely.
  • Place, replace, and rearrange splitters to ensure proper network functionality.
  • Utilize a company assigned electronic devices for work orders, diagnostics, documentation, and communication
  • Reads and interprets customer service orders, technical (i.e., mechanical, electrical, digital) drawings, maps, blueprints, diagrams, etc.
  • Receives service orders, worksheets, (detailed diagrams describing the nature and location of equipment to be installed or repair) and repair tickets from supervisor or other designated employees and performs specified work.
